For 20 years, Melbourne-based Mister Magnets has been working with companies around Australia to help them raise their brand awareness and promote their products and services on promotional magnets that can be stuck to fridges, filing cabinets, computers, white boards and even cars.
Established in 1989, Mister Magnets is Australia’s largest manufacturer of promotional magnets, producing more than 12 million fridge, business card, calendar and other magnet products per year. Its 30,000-plus client base is as diverse as the magnets it produces, ranging from small one-person businesses through to the very largest companies in the country, including ANZ Bank, McDonald’s, AMP, Jim’s Franchisees, Telstra, Dick Smith, BMW and various Real Estate companies.
“More and more businesses are realising that promotional magnets are an excellent, long-term form of advertising because once the end user puts them in a visible place, such as on a fridge or filing cabinet, they are likely to contact you when they need your specific service,” says Mister Magnets Managing Director, Mark Milgate.
